Governor AbdulRazaq Waives Nomination Fees for Female Aspirants and Disabled Persons

Date: 2024-06-23

According to a news report from Voice of Nigeria, the Governor of Kwara State, AbdulRahman AbdulRazaq, has announced that female aspirants and persons with disabilities will be exempt from paying for the Kwara All Progressives Congress (APC) Local Government election nomination forms.

In a statement by the Governor's aide on New Media, Olayinka Fafoluyi, it was declared that these two groups would receive the forms free of charge. This decision is part of the Governor's HeforShe empathy initiative.

Additionally, the APC in Kwara State has paused the sale of nomination forms for chairmanship and councilorship aspirants for the upcoming local government elections. The State Chairman of the Local Government Election Committee, Abdullahi Abubakar Samari, mentioned to VON that only those who have been selected as the party's consensus candidates will be allowed to purchase the forms once the sale resumes.

The electoral committee had earlier announced to all intending aspirants and stakeholders that the sale of forms for the forthcoming Local Government council election will commence on the 21st of June, 2024.

According to the announcement, aspirants are to purchase forms by paying the prescribed fee into the party's Fidelity bank account with account name: APC Kwara Chapter and account number 4011458044.

It added that the teller obtained from the payment should be brought to the Chairman, Finance Sub-committee at the party secretariat for documentation.

The statement also declared that once the payment is verified, receipt would be issued along with the application form.

Aspirants are to note also that the sale of forms closes on the 25th of June at 12 noon.

The Chairmanship form goes for a million naira while Councilorship form goes for N250,000.

The statement further emphasized that both chairmanship and councilorship forms are free for women and the physically challenged aspirants.
